> The size of physical memory in my test machine is 229G, the size of
> mirror region is 26G. In the 100 times, 50 times are with this patchset,
> 50 times are without it.
> 
> Here is my test result:
> 
> ------------------------------------------------
>             |total times|in non-mirror|in mirror
> ------------|-----------|-------------|---------
> before patch|     50    |      41     |   9
> ------------|-----------|-------------|---------
> with patch  |     50    |       0     |  50
> ------------------------------------------------
> 
> Firstly, I add the earlyprintk to get efi map when walking the efi map.
> Then get the range of mirror regions.
> In kaslr.c, add the earlyprintk to get random_addr in function
> choose_random_location, find_random_phys_addr. Then check if the address
> in which is choosen to extract kernel is in mirror region.

> >Our customer reported that Kernel text may be located on non-mirror
> >region (movable zone) when both address range mirroring feature and
> >KASLR are enabled.
> >
> >The functions of address range mirroring feature are as follows.
> >- The physical memory region whose descriptors in EFI memory map have
> >  EFI_MEMORY_MORE_RELIABLE attribute (bit: 16) are mirrored
> >- The function arranges such mirror region into normal zone and other region
> >  into movable zone in order to locate kernel code and data on mirror region
> >
> >So we need restrict kernel to be located inside mirror region if it
> >is existed.
> >
> >The method is very simple. If efi is enabled, just iterate all efi
> >memory map and pick up mirror region to process for adding candidate
> >of slot. If efi disabled or no mirror region existed, still process
> >e820 memory map. This won't bring much efficiency loss, at worst we
> >just go through all efi memory maps and found no mirror.
> >
> >One question:
> >From code, though mirror regions are existed, they are meaningful only
> >if kernelcore=mirror kernel option is specified. Not sure if my understanding
> >is correct.
